This dresser was in good condition and it had the original hardware! It is always a good thing when a piece of furniture has all the original hardware.

hardware

The dresser was in good condition but it did need a lot of MUD to fill in some missing veneer and some other areas to smooth out the surface and make it flush before painting it.

Once the MUD was fully dry, it was time for a scuff-sand. 

Ever since I got THIS SANDER, it is the only one I grab when I am working on furniture pieces. (I put my coupon code for this sander in the supply list above).

scuff sanding

A scuff-sand is a good thing to do when flipping furniture. You aren’t sanding down to bare wood. You just want to rough up the surface so the primer and paint stick well. The scuff-sand will help smooth out the wood as well.

silk mineral paint dixie belle paint

When the scuff-sand was done, I used a damp cloth and wiped away any sanding dust left on the dresser. Now, it was time to prime, paint, and topcoat with one product. Yep! ONLY ONE PRODUCT TO DO ALL THREE!

Dixie Belle Paint released an all-in-one mineral paint and I LOVE it. It makes my furniture projects done in no time! I can get the priming, painting, and topcoat done in one application. ONE!

After two coats, this dresser was done!

That was it!

Not two coats of primer, two coats of paint, and two coats of topcoat. NOPE! Just two coats of Silk paint that has the primer, paint, and topcoat in it.
